Six Cheney High School seniors were nominated for Spokane Scholar Awards; they are among 160 students nominated from 30 schools throughout the Spokane region.
The Spokane Scholars Foundation was founded in 1993 by community members and business leaders to recognize academic excellence among students in the Spokane region. Students are nominated in one of six academic areas.
All six nominees from Cheney High School were among the students honored at the annual Spokane Scholar Banquet on April 10th. The top 4 scholars in each category also received cash awards with matching one-year scholarships from local universities. One of our Cheney High School students, Terrence Yu, won the 3rd place prize in Mathematics. Congratulations to all of our Spokane Scholar nominees!
